This pub dates back to 1378. It’s a low beamed building so watch your head. Menu was good and food delicious. Staff helpful and friendly. There was a real fireplace burning. It’s a very kids friendly and dog friendly place. Customer car park round the back and beer garden for warmer months.

Visited for Valentines evening. Pre booked and paid £25 deposit which came off the bill. Food - Outstanding! We had Starters/Mains & Dessert which all did not disappoint. Food portions are very generous for what you pay. What you want from a lovely country pub. The only small let down was the Service. Now I understand it was Valentine’s and the pub was full but upon arriving our welcome drinks of Prosecco took quite a while to arrive - about 15-20 minutes. Once our drinks arrived we ordered food pretty much straight away. After the starters we ordered more drinks but this again took a considerable about of time to arrive, so I had to ask where our drinks were. Once we had finished our mains, we asked to see the dessert menu but again this took around 30 mins to come. To the point that I asked the lady again who cleared our plates if we could have those dessert menus. I couldn’t help thinking that because we weren’t sitting in the main bar area our tables were forgotten about. I wanted to share this mainly because my Wife & I were so pleased with the food. Had we not had to ask several times for our drinks to arrive and the menu it would have been the perfect visit.

Decided to arrange a birthday meal for a family friend as a surprise. 20 of us met up and prebooked food and paid deposit. Food was ok. mortified when we got our birthday cake out and they told us they would charge us £80 for eating our cake there!!!! I have never heard of this cakerage fee before. Waitresses were hugely embarrassed but boss would not back down or come out to us. Felt bad for the poor girls serving us. We spent a fair amount on food and drink so this really did spoil what was supposed to be a good night. We ended up going to a local pub up the road afterwards who welcomed us with the cake and didn’t charge us. No wonder some restaurants are struggling. I would never go back there and now understand how the local residents feel about their negative experiences there.
